Get unlocked HTC One with $0 down 0% interest financing

In order to spice-up sales during the holiday season, HTC has launched a simple (and affordable) and financing plan for users interested in buying the unlocked HTC One smartphone. The Taiwanese company is offering $0 down 0% financing, allowing users to pay for the phone over the next 24 months. If you pay your dues in time, you pay no interest. However, if you fall behind on payments, you’ll be charged at a whopping 29.99% interest. So you better know what you’re doing and manage your finances wisely.

Again, the deal applies to unlocked 32GB units, which you can later use with AT&T’s and T-Mobile’s networks.

As you know, the HTC One is one of the best phones you can buy today. Although it doesn’t rock Qualcomm’s fastest chip (Snapdragon 800), it does deliver rock-solid performance and its metal body makes it one of the sexiest phones on the planet. Or so I think…
